Tailor your cover letter to the job advertisement. If they said they want someone with leadership skills, mention times you have shown leadership. Always look for ways that you can distinguish yourself from other candidates with regards to what they are looking for in their advertisement.

Go to a lot of job fairs when you are looking for work. They can be really instructional and give you lots of intel on what types of jobs are out there. You can also gain some great contacts that can aide you in getting the right job.

Don’t think that you only should take one kind of job, because there are jobs out there that have a few different titles. Use the Internet to locate related job titles. This broadens the range of jobs that you can get.
